TX

A TX object is used to represent each transmitter in the GTs.

Reset

To reset the TX, use the reset() method

# Get all IBERT cores in the device and select the first IBERT core for use
iberts = device.ibert_cores
ibert_0 = ibert.at(index=0)

# Get all the GT Groups in the IBERT core
all_gt_groups = ibert_0.gt_groups

# Get the first GT Group and the first GT in the GT Group
first_gt_group = all_gt_groups.at(index=0)
first_gt = first_gt_group.gts.at(index=0)

first_gt.tx.reset()

Attributes of TX object

The attributes of the TX class instance are listed here and are accessible via the python . operator i.e. <tx_obj>.<attribute>.

TX attributes

Attribute

Description

name

Name of the TX

type

Serial object type. This is always equal to RX_KEY

handle

Handle of the TX from cs_server

pll

PLL driving this TX

link

Link for the TX, if any